You can resize your images with pretty much most Image programmes. The reason we limit the size is because for one/ not all are working with ethernet and two/ every-so-often someone would post a file so big that by the time the page finally loaded there would be a picture of a lug nut where there was supposed to be a complete Delica. Picasa has a simple one that says "forum size".

Also noted you had some old VW's pics....looked like models. There was a genre of Hot-Rod in Alberta called VW HoodRide. All manner and shape of VW's. Many owners left the rust and dents from past history, the group liked to highlight the patina of their old rides.
